What they do
A Registered Nurse provides medical care and treatment, educates patients about their conditions, and provides emotional support to patients and families. Works in hospitals, schools, clinics or community health centers. Works under the supervision of a physician or other specialist, and serves as the primary point of care for patients in a hospital setting. May specialize in emergency room work, or treatment for a particular condition, or specialize in working with infants, the elderly or other patient groups. May work as an advanced practice specialists and prescribe medications in addition to offering specialty care.

Job Description
Cura Health operates across healthcare and senior care, supporting nursing homes and assisted living communities with the people and processes that help care settings run smoothly. Our work spans essential clinical and operational functions, and this role plays an important part in keeping billing activity accurate, timely, and well coordinated across the organization. As a Nursing Home/Assisted Living Corporate Biller, you will help maintain the financial processes that support reimbursement and account follow-through for senior care services. This role is focused on accuracy, responsiveness, and coordination, with close partnership across facility teams to keep documentation and billing workflows moving effectively. Responsibilities Manage billing processes for nursing home and assisted living accounts. Review claims for accuracy and resolve billing discrepancies promptly. Coordinate with facility teams to gather documentation for reimbursement. Monitor accounts receivable and follow up on unpaid balances. Ensure compliance with Medicare, Medicaid, and payer billing requirements. Requirements Accounting experience. Educational background in accounting or bookkeeping. Proficiency with basic Microsoft systems. Professional proficiency in English. Eligibility to work in the United States. Prior billing experience is a plus. Experience coordinating with facility teams, insurance or payer contacts, residents' families, and internal finance staff is a plus.
